Supreme Court Won’t Hear Fireworks Company’s Dispute With Consumer Product Regulator

Summary by The Epoch Times
The Supreme Court has turned away an appeal by a fireworks company challenging notices the Consumer Product Safety Commission issued that stated their products ran afoul of federal standards. The denial of the petition on May 19 in Jake’s Fireworks Inc. v. Consumer Product Safety Commission took the form of an unsigned order. No justices dissented. The court did not explain its decision.
